Exploring API Integration Options for Custom Data Retrieval

Posted on August 21, 2024

I’m currently working on a project that involves integrating various APIs to retrieve and manage custom data for a web application. Specifically, I’m interested in how to efficiently fetch and utilize external data, such as financial information, within my app. For instance, I’m considering the integration of APIs that provide information similar to what one might find in sources related to financial profiles/

I’d love to hear about your experiences and recommendations for handling API integrations on the DigitalOcean platform. What tools or best practices have you found effective for:

  1. Efficient API data retrieval and processing?
  2. Handling large volumes of data?
  3. Ensuring API responses are managed securely and effectively?

1. Efficient API Data Retrieval and Processing

  • Use Asynchronous Requests: When you’re fetching data from multiple APIs or dealing with large datasets, asynchronous requests are your best friend. This way, you can retrieve data from multiple sources simultaneously, cutting down on wait times. In Node.js, for example, you can use axios with async/await or in Python, try aiohttp.

  • Leverage DigitalOcean Functions: If you need to process API requests on the fly, consider using DigitalOcean Functions. They allow you to run serverless functions, which can handle API calls asynchronously without worrying about server management. Plus, it scales automatically based on the workload.

  • Caching with DigitalOcean Managed Databases: Use DigitalOcean Managed Databases like Redis to cache API responses. This can drastically reduce the number of API calls you need to make and improve your app’s performance. Redis is particularly useful for caching frequently requested data, so your users get faster responses.

2. Handling Large Volumes of Data

  • Batch Processing: If you’re pulling in large volumes of data, consider batching your requests. This helps to avoid overloading your system. With DigitalOcean’s Droplets, you can set up dedicated VMs to handle these batch processes efficiently.

  • Streaming Data with DigitalOcean App Platform: For real-time data processing, check out the DigitalOcean App Platform. It supports WebSockets and other protocols that make streaming data from your APIs a breeze. You can also easily deploy and scale your web apps here.

  • Database Optimization: Optimize your database to handle large data sets by using DigitalOcean’s Managed Databases. Make sure you’re using indexes effectively and consider using PostgreSQL for its robustness and scalability, especially when dealing with complex financial data.

3. Ensuring API Responses are Managed Securely

  • Secure Connections with DigitalOcean VPC: Use DigitalOcean VPC (Virtual Private Cloud) to ensure that your API traffic is secure and isolated from the public internet. This adds an extra layer of security to your API interactions.

  • API Gateway and Firewalls: Set up an API gateway using DigitalOcean Load Balancers and enforce security rules with DigitalOcean Cloud Firewalls. This way, you can manage access to your APIs and protect against malicious traffic.

  • Environment Isolation with Spaces and Kubernetes: If your API requires dealing with large files, DigitalOcean Spaces is perfect for storing and serving large volumes of data. For containerized workloads, consider DigitalOcean Kubernetes, which allows you to run isolated environments and scale easily.
